Transaction 79333c447cbaea673264d3f14f9c4229c16c2d998665a419667006205b2ad692

3 Input
2 Outputs
  • 79333c447cbaea673264d3f14f9c4229c16c2d998665a419667006205b2ad692:0
  • value  3988827
    address  12JQRT6AkyZZ8TeDaSfdCvaeDn39faHVin
  • 79333c447cbaea673264d3f14f9c4229c16c2d998665a419667006205b2ad692:1
  • value  1296792
    address  15FEVEEeuUwu72VQ8PsMR141QytUcmCYBf